Job Summary:

Toptal is an innovative organization that is disrupting the global professional services and talent market. In response to our clients’ overwhelming demand for exceptional talent in new areas, we are expanding the breadth and depth of our Technology Services offerings to further fuel that growth. As Toptal’s VP, AI Practice, you will define and execute our strategy for artificial intelligence, machine learning, and generative AI services - from strategic advisory to full-scale AI solution delivery. You will combine deep technical expertise with business acumen to build offerings that address market demand, differentiate Toptal in a crowded AI market, and deliver measurable impact for clients.
This leader will be a proven expert in AI, ML, and Gen AI, with a deep understanding of cross-industry target buyers, their priorities, and the trends impacting them. The ideal candidate for this position will have led initiatives across AI governance, machine learning model development, natural language processing (NLP), large language models (LLMs), computer vision, and AI productization. You will determine what services to build, how to price and package them, and how to position our value proposition to meet client needs today and in the future.

Responsibilities:

The following information is intended to describe the general nature and level of work being performed. It is not intended to be an exhaustive list of all duties, responsibilities, or required skills.
You will be responsible for building and scaling Toptal’s AI/ML practice, including:
  • Strategy: Identify high-value client problems in AI/ML and develop a roadmap for offerings that address them.
  • Offering Development: Create services in areas including LLM integration, custom model training, AI strategy consulting, and AI-powered analytics.
  • Go-to-Market: Lead initial market engagements to validate offerings, then scale adoption in collaboration with Sales and Practice Operations teams.
  • Thought Leadership: Represent Toptal as an AI innovation leader via publications, speaking engagements, and community involvement.
  • Sales Enablement: Educate sales teams on AI/ML concepts, emerging trends, and value propositions; personally lead key client discussions.
  • P&L Ownership: Oversee financial performance of the AI/ML practice.
  • Talent Network Development: Build and maintain a network of AI engineers, data scientists, and ML researchers with cutting-edge expertise.
  • Accomplish work objectives through leading and supervising other Toptal team members within the AI/ML Practice.
  • Establish objectives and initiatives for the team, recommend the team’s structure and jobs, and organize, assign, delegate, oversee, and monitor work.
  • Coach and mentor team members, provide feedback, conduct performance reviews, and implement performance improvement plans, if needed.

Qualifications and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ering is required. Master’s degree in Engineering, Business, or a related field preferred.
  • 15+ years of experience in Technology Services and/or Product, with 10+ years of experience in AI/ML, including deep exposure in enterprise AI initiatives.
  • Strong expertise in machine learning, deep learning, NLP, LLMs, and AI governance.
  • Proficiency with Python, TensorFlow, PyTorch, and ML Ops tools.
  • Track record of leading AI commercialization and productization efforts.
  • P&L ownership experience in a technology services context.
  • Industry experience in sectors like marketing, finance, healthcare, or e-commerce.
  • Strong ability to bridge technical and business conversations with both executives and engineers.
  • This role is highly collaborative and will work extremely closely with Toptal’s Marketing, Sales, and Talent Operations teams to fulfill the above responsibilities.
  • Outstanding written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, rapidly growing company and handle a wide variety of challenges, deadlines, and a diverse array of contacts.

Toptal is a global network of the top talent in business, design, and technology that enables companies to scale their teams, on-demand. With $200+ million in annual revenue and over 40% year-over-year growth, Toptal is the largest fully distributed workforce in the world.

The Toptal network includes thousands of designers, developers, and finance experts in more than 100 countries. To be accepted into the network, all Toptalers must pass a screening process that includes communication skills and a variety of technical exams specific to the applicant's area of expertise.
